Ultra-High Temperature Ceramics are promising materials for hypersonic aircraft parts because they offer good thermomechanical properties under extreme conditions and they do it without compromising the integrity of the overall structure, Dr Tallon says.
The UHTCs can also be formed into complex shapes.
Using chemistry to modify a standard method of casting ceramics in a mould, the researchers have developed an alternative to the traditional technique of forming these ceramics as blocks at high temperatures and pressures.
